How to bulk update Weaning

This new process makes it much quicker to perform all of the following updates, but still flexible enough to cater for all different options for each farm.

  • Update Horse Type from Foal to Weanling;
  • Update Weanling Location, Status and Barn/Paddock; and
  • Update the Horse Category, Location, Status and barn/Paddock for each Mare of each of the weanlings.

Go to Utilities > Bulk Data Update.


Select Weaning.


Using the filters if necessary, select desired Foal(s) and then assign a new Horse Type (Weanling), and optionally a new LocationStatus and Barn/Paddock (select from the list).


Ensure you select the Foals using the checkbox to the left of the Foal's name.


Click Next


The Mare's of the weanlings will appear in the next screen.


Follow the same process to update (if necessary) the Mare's Horse Category (e.g. Wet Mare), LocationStatus and Barn/Paddock.


We have intentionally allowed users to select appropriate categories and statuses as each farm uses different categories and statuses.

Again, ensure you tick the check box next to each Mare you wish to update.


Then click either:

  • Save - to process the changes; or
  • Save & Add Expense - to process the changes and apply a relevant Procedure (which will record your selected Procedure on the applicable date and create expense charges to owners if one it set up in Finance Rules)
